Output 28592ed91e2ab00ee74a9cb775689fb97dfea98f5de95c69c3b28869af011321:0

value
1093982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f678564c6e0ccc6eee7b84544ab581fac6def3 OP_EQUAL
address
3P7PJUMs8zEWpUpAG3xgiFXmLYWFxEryaJ
transaction
28592ed91e2ab00ee74a9cb775689fb97dfea98f5de95c69c3b28869af011321
spent
true